Whether conducted online or on-site, instructor-led live Microservices training courses use hands-on practice to demonstrate the fundamentals of microservice architecture and how to develop microservice applications.
Microservices training is available as "online live training" or "onsite live training". Online live training (also referred to as "remote live training") is delivered via an interactive, remote desktop. Onsite live training can be conducted locally at customer premises in Nepal or at NobleProg corporate training centers in Nepal.
Microservices is also known as Microservice Architecture.
NobleProg -- Your Local Training Provider
Nepal, Kathmandu - Classroom
near Soaltee, Tahachal Marg, Kathmandu, Nepal, 44600
Set in Kathmandu, this classroom is well located near Tahachal Marg with all amenities and WiFi.
For Sales Enquires and Meetings
All our centres have batches running on weekdays and weekends hence, please note that, in most cases, usually we are not able to organise ad hoc sales meetings, especially on our classrooms as they are all occupied with ongoing training sessions . Please contact us by e-mail or phone at least one day earlier to make an appointment with one of our consultants at our corporate offices.
Nepal, Thamel, KTM - Classroom
near Radisson , Ward 2, Kathmandu, Nepal, 44600
Set in Kathmandu, this classroom is well located near Thamel, with all amenities and WiFi.
For Sales Enquires and Meetings
All our centres have batches running on weekdays and weekends hence, please note that, in most cases, usually we are not able to organise ad hoc sales meetings, especially on our classrooms as they are all occupied with ongoing training sessions . Please contact us by e-mail or phone at least one day earlier to make an appointment with one of our consultants at our corporate offices.
Confluent Apache Kafka is an enterprise-grade distributed event streaming platform built on Apache Kafka. It supports high-throughput, fault-tolerant data pipelines and real-time streaming applications.
This instructor-led, live training (online or onsite) is aimed at intermediate-level engineers and administrators who wish to deploy, configure, and optimize Confluent Kafka clusters in production environments.
By the end of this training, participants will be able to:
Install, configure, and operate Confluent Kafka clusters with multiple brokers.
Design high-availability setups using Zookeeper and replication techniques.
Tune performance, monitor metrics, and apply recovery strategies.
Secure, scale, and integrate Kafka with enterprise environments.
Format of the Course
Interactive lecture and discussion.
Lots of exercises and practice.
Hands-on implementation in a live-lab environment.
Course Customization Options
To request a customized training for this course, please contact us to arrange.
Confluent Apache Kafka is a distributed event streaming platform built for high-throughput, fault-tolerant data pipelines and real-time analytics.
This instructor-led, live training (available online or onsite) is designed for intermediate-level system administrators and DevOps professionals who want to install, configure, monitor, and troubleshoot Confluent Apache Kafka clusters.
By the end of this training, participants will be able to:
Understand the components and architecture of Confluent Kafka.
Deploy and manage Kafka brokers, Zookeeper quorums, and key services.
Configure advanced features including security, replication, and performance tuning.
Use management tools to monitor and maintain Kafka clusters.
Format of the Course
Interactive lecture and discussion.
Plenty of exercises and practice.
Hands-on implementation in a live-lab environment.
Course Customization Options
To request a customized training for this course, please contact us to arrange.
This instructor-led, live training in Nepal (online or onsite) is aimed at intermediate-level Java developers who wish to integrate Apache Kafka into their applications for reliable, scalable, and high-throughput messaging.
By the end of this training, participants will be able to:
Understand the architecture and core components of Kafka.
Set up and configure a Kafka cluster.
Produce and consume messages using Java.
Implement Kafka Streams for real-time data processing.
Ensure fault tolerance and scalability in Kafka applications.
This instructor-led, live training in Nepal (online or onsite) is designed for intermediate to advanced developers, DevOps professionals, and architects who wish to design, deploy, and manage resilient applications using microservices, containers, and continuous integration/continuous deployment (CI/CD) pipelines.
Upon completion of this training, participants will be able to:
Understand and implement microservices architecture.
Deploy and manage containerized applications using Docker and Kubernetes.
Establish and optimize CI/CD pipelines for automated deployments.
Apply best practices for security, monitoring, and observability.
This instructor-led, live training in Nepal (online or onsite) is designed for advanced-level platform engineers and DevOps professionals aiming to master application scaling through microservices and Kubernetes.
Upon completion of this training, participants will be able to:
Design and implement scalable microservices architectures.
Deploy and manage applications on Kubernetes clusters.
Leverage Helm charts for efficient service deployment.
Monitor and maintain the health of microservices in production environments.
Apply security and compliance best practices within a Kubernetes environment.
This instructor-led, live training in Nepal (online or onsite) is designed for intermediate-level Java developers who aim to design, develop, deploy, and maintain microservices-based applications using Java frameworks like Spring Boot and Spring Cloud.
By the end of this training, participants will be able to:
Grasp the core principles and advantages of microservices architecture.
Construct and deploy microservices using Java and Spring Boot.
Implement service discovery, configuration management, and API gateways.
Effectively secure, monitor, and scale microservices.
Deploy microservices leveraging Docker and Kubernetes.
This instructor-led, live training in Nepal (online or onsite) is designed for experienced developers looking to build, deploy, and scale applications using microservices powered by NodeJS and React.
Upon completing this training, participants will be able to:
Create, deploy, and scale applications using various microservices.
Develop a server-side rendered React application.
Deploy multi-service applications to the cloud using Docker and Kubernetes.
This instructor-led live training in Nepal (online or onsite) is designed for developers, integration architects, and system administrators who wish to master advanced integration patterns and techniques using Apache Camel.
By the end of this training, participants will be able to:
Understand advanced integration patterns and techniques.
Implement complex routing and transformations.
Optimize performance and scalability.
Handle errors and exceptions in complex integration scenarios.
Integrate Apache Camel with various technologies and platforms.
This instructor-led, live training in Nepal (online or onsite) is aimed at intermediate-level developers who wish to develop big data applications with Apache Kafka.
By the end of this training, participants will be able to:
Develop Kafka producers and consumers to send and read data from Kafka.
Integrate Kafka with external systems using Kafka Connect.
Write streaming applications with Kafka Streams & ksqlDB.
Integrate a Kafka client application with Confluent Cloud for cloud-based Kafka deployments.
Gain practical experience through hands-on exercises and real-world use cases.
This instructor-led, live training in Nepal (available online or onsite) is designed for intermediate to advanced developers aiming to master the development of microservices using Spring Boot, Docker, and Kubernetes.
By the end of this training, participants will be able to:
Grasp the fundamental principles of microservices architecture.
Develop production-ready microservices using Spring Boot.
Appreciate the pivotal role of Docker in containerizing microservices.
Set up Kubernetes clusters for the deployment and orchestration of microservices.
This instructor-led, live training in Nepal (online or onsite) is aimed at intermediate-level developers and DevOps engineers who wish to build, deploy, and manage microservices using Spring Cloud and Docker.
By the end of this training, participants will be able to:
Develop microservices using Spring Boot and Spring Cloud.
Containerize applications with Docker and Docker Compose.
Implement service discovery, API gateways, and inter-service communication.
Monitor and secure microservices in production environments.
Deploy and orchestrate microservices using Kubernetes.
This instructor-led, live training in Nepal (online or onsite) is aimed at intermediate-level to advanced-level developers and architects who wish to develop Java native applications and microservices using Quarkus with optimized memory usage and startup time.
By the end of this training, participants will be able to:
Develop high-performance, lightweight Java native applications using Quarkus.
Build and deploy RESTful services and microservices architectures.
Use GraalVM for native compilation and optimize startup and memory efficiency.
Package and containerize applications for Kubernetes and OpenShift environments.
Explore RabbitMQ, the open-source message broker that enables reliable, high-throughput distributed systems across the globe. This course covers essential AMQP protocol concepts, message routing techniques, cluster deployment, and high-availability setups. Participants will learn to administer queues, configure mirrored workloads, implement load-balanced failover mechanisms, and secure exchanges. Additionally, the curriculum includes integration with the REST API and management plugins, building proficiency in deploying production-grade messaging infrastructure on Linux.
This instructor-led live training Nepal (online or onsite) is targeted at software architects and web developers who wish to use RabbitMQ as messaging middleware and program in Java using Spring to build applications.
By the end of this training, participants will be able to:
Use Java and Spring with RabbitMQ to build applications.
Design asynchronous message driven systems using RabbitMQ.
Create and apply queues, topics, exchanges, and bindings in RabbitMQ
In this instructor-led, live training in Nepal, participants will learn how to install, configure, and administer RabbitMQ, then integrate RabbitMQ messaging into several sample .NET applications.
By the end of this training, participants will be able to:
Set up, configure, and manage RabbitMQ.
Understand RabbitMQ's role in the design and implementation of a microservices architecture.
Understand how RabbitMQ compares to other message queuing architectures.
Set up and use RabbitMQ as a broker for handling asynchronous and synchronous messages for real-world enterprise .NET applications.
This instructor-led, live training in Nepal (online or on-site) is designed for developers and software engineers who wish to utilize RabbitMQ for communication between microservices via messaging and to perform advanced implementation and troubleshooting.
By the end of this training, participants will be able to:
Set up the necessary environment to start developing advanced messaging solutions with RabbitMQ.
Understand how to design a distributed microservices architecture with RabbitMQ.
Learn how to implement advanced configuration, security, networking, high availability, and replication.
Know the common issues encountered in RabbitMQ installations and how to resolve them.
Learn about memory optimization, flow control, and advanced performance tuning.
Istio is an open-source service mesh designed to operate on Kubernetes, offering secure, transparent, and manageable connectivity between microservices. By utilizing Istio’s Envoy-based sidecar proxies, development teams can enforce strict policies, secure inter-service communications through mutual TLS (mTLS), gain comprehensive visibility into traffic patterns, and enhance reliability as systems scale.
This instructor-led live training session, available either online or on-site, targets intermediate-level engineers looking to deploy, secure, and manage microservices applications using Istio within Kubernetes environments.
Upon completing this training, participants will be equipped to:
Install and configure Istio on Kubernetes clusters.
Comprehend and implement service mesh concepts, encompassing traffic management, security, and observability.
Deploy microservices applications within an Istio service mesh framework.
Secure service-to-service communications using mutual TLS (mTLS) and adhere to Zero Trust principles.
Monitor, trace, and troubleshoot microservices using Prometheus, Grafana, and Jaeger.
Integrate Istio with Calico to implement advanced network policies and enhance security.
Course Format
Interactive lectures and discussions.
Extensive exercises and practical practice sessions.
Hands-on implementation within a live laboratory environment.
Course Customization Options
To request a customized training session for this course, please contact us to make arrangements.
In this instructor-led live training in Nepal (online or onsite), participants will learn how to decouple a Python application and integrate it with the RabbitMQ messaging system to create distributed cloud applications or microservices.
By the end of this training, participants will be able to:
Set up, configure, and manage RabbitMQ.
Grasp RabbitMQ's role in the design and implementation of microservice architecture.
Understand how RabbitMQ compares to other Message Queuing architectures.
Set up and utilize RabbitMQ as a broker to handle both asynchronous and synchronous messages for real-world Python applications.
Apache Camel provides a powerful framework for enterprise application integration and message routing. This course delves into fundamental concepts such as routing, message transformation, error handling strategies, component connectors, Enterprise Integration Patterns, and transaction management. It guides developers through the practical configuration of route definitions, bean wiring, concurrency control, and monitoring techniques. By mastering these skills, practitioners will be equipped to design reliable microservice communication layers and streamline complex data workflows.
This instructor-led live training in Nepal (online or onsite) is aimed at developers who wish to learn how to build, test, debug and deploy an API on top of Google Cloud's Apigee API Platform.
By the end of this training, participants will be able to:
Set up a development environment that includes all needed resources to start developing an API.
Understand and implement the tools available within Apigee Edge.
Build and deploy an API to Google Cloud.
Monitor and debug API errors.
Leverage Google Cloud's analytics and machine learning solutions to make APIs more intelligent.
Built on Java, Apigee Edge allows you to deliver secure access to your services through a consistent and well-defined API, irrespective of the underlying service implementation. A uniform API offers the following advantages:
Simplifies the process for application developers to consume your services.
Permits changes to the backend service implementation without impacting the public-facing API.
Enables you to leverage the analytics, monetization, developer portal, and other features natively integrated into Edge.
Audience
This course is designed for engineers, architects, and developers who aim to integrate Apigee Edge into their projects.
This course offers a comprehensive, hands-on journey through the design, construction, and operation of cloud-native microservices. Emphasizing practical implementation over theoretical concepts, it guides participants from domain modelling and service design to deployment, observability, and resilience within production environments.
Participants will engage in building a real-world microservices architecture, learning to avoid common pitfalls like distributed monoliths while adopting best practices for scalability, maintainability, and operational excellence.
This instructor-led, live training in Nepal (online or onsite) is aimed at system administrators and MQ administrators who wish to master advanced configuration, security, clustering, high availability, and troubleshooting of IBM MQ 9.4 in distributed deployments.
This training is designed for enterprise architects, software developers, system administrators, and professionals seeking to grasp and leverage high-throughput distributed messaging systems. While broadly applicable, the curriculum can be customized to address specific requirements, such as focusing exclusively on system administration aspects, to better align with your organizational needs.
This instructor-led, live training in Nepal (online or onsite) is aimed at beginner-level, intermediate-level, or advanced-level system administrators and operations engineers who wish to use Apache Kafka to deploy, secure, monitor, and troubleshoot Kafka clusters.
By the end of this training, participants will be able to explain Kafka architecture and KRaft mode, operate and secure Kafka clusters, monitor performance and reliability, and resolve common production issues.
This instructor-led, live training in Nepal (online or onsite) is aimed at intermediate-level software developers, system architects, and DevOps professionals who wish to build scalable and maintainable applications using a microservices architecture.
By the end of this training, participants will be able to:
Understand the core principles of microservices architecture.
Design and implement scalable microservice-based systems.
Apply design patterns and best practices for microservices.
Implement event-driven approaches such as CQRS and event sourcing.
Address challenges in system operations and microservices adoption.
In this instructor-led live training conducted at Nepal, participants will master the essentials of building microservices using Spring Cloud and Docker. Through practical exercises and the step-by-step construction of sample microservices, participants will have their knowledge tested and refined.
By the conclusion of this training, participants will be able to:
Understand the fundamentals of microservices.
Use Docker to build containers for microservice applications.
Build and deploy containerized microservices using Spring Cloud and Docker.
Integrate microservices with discovery services and the Spring Cloud API Gateway.
Use Docker Compose for end-to-end integration testing.
In this instructor-led live training in Nepal, participants will explore the features, concepts, and standards behind WSO2 API Manager. The curriculum combines theoretical insights with live, hands-on practice and implementation. By the end of the course, participants will be equipped with the knowledge and practical skills to deploy their own APIs using the core features of WSO2 API Manager.
Read more...
Last Updated:
Testimonials (10)
About the microservices and how to maintenance kubernetes
Yufri Isnaini Rochmat Maulana - Bank Indonesia
Course - Advanced Platform Engineering: Scaling with Microservices and Kubernetes
The instructor was knowledgeable about the course topic and also other related topics, and was able to answer our questions, or even make a note of questions he didn't immediately know the answer to and got back to use later.
Abe Sabbagh - Enbridge
Course - Advanced RabbitMQ - 2 Days
The flexibility to the agenda and considering the provided topics which we currently deal with.
It was great to exchange on the knowledge and experiences!
Fabian - Continental Barum s.r.o.
Course - RabbitMQ
Possibility to perform independent exercises in the training environment.
Tomasz - PKO Zycie Towarzystwo Ubezpieczen S.A.
Course - Kafka for Administrators
To have full understanding of WSO2 API Manger and it importance.The fundamentals really helped me to go and advanced self-learning
Hlalefang Nkhooa - Revenue Services Lesotho
Course - WSO2 API Manager for Developers
Very practical examples. The trainer has tried to keep a pace where everybody is able to go with even though the group was quite inhomogeneous regarding the knowhow. He has provided a lot of support to basically everybody who asked for it :)
Georgi - BMW SA
Course - Apache Kafka for Developers
Friendly environment. Also, I liked one on one training. It’s very productive. I would definitely recommend it to my friends and colleagues.
Zeed - Tamkeen Technologies
Course - Building Microservices with NodeJS and React
I was a good mix of practical and theoretical information. Engaging presentation with real world examples.
Anita
Course - Building Microservice Architectures
The knowledge provided covered all aspects that we could need for our current apache camel implementations.
Leon - Vos Management & Logistical Development B.V.
Course - Apache Camel
Flexibility to cover the subjects I am most intrested in
Online Microservice Architecture training in Nepal, Microservice Architecture training courses in Nepal, Weekend Microservice Architecture courses in Nepal, Evening Microservices training in Nepal, Microservices instructor-led in Nepal, Microservice Architecture trainer in Nepal, Microservice Architecture instructor-led in Nepal, Microservice Architecture on-site in Nepal, Microservice Architecture coaching in Nepal, Microservice Architecture boot camp in Nepal, Weekend Microservice Architecture training in Nepal, Microservices private courses in Nepal, Online Microservice Architecture training in Nepal, Evening Microservices courses in Nepal, Microservice Architecture classes in Nepal, Microservice Architecture one on one training in Nepal, Microservice Architecture instructor in Nepal